Paxos Highlights Global Stablecoin Rulebook as U.S., EU and Singapore Tighten Oversight

In the United States, the GENIUS Act of 2025 establishes a federal licensing regime for payment stablecoin issuers, permitting only approved bank subsidiaries or qualified non-bank entities to issue dollar-backed tokens. The law mandates one-to-one reserves, monthly third-party reserve attestations and strict AML compliance, while granting holders priority in insolvency. ...

South Korea Targets Crypto, Stock ‘Finfluencers’ With Strict Disclosure Rules

South Korea plans to increase oversight of online investment promotions. New legislative proposals would require cryptocurrency and stock influencers to publicly share their financial interests and any paid partnerships. Bitcoin Gamma Exposure Signals High Volatility as Coinbase Warns of Accelerated $60,000 Downside

Coinbase Institutional has unveiled a new market analysis introducing the "Gamma Exposure (GEX)" metric to evaluate Bitcoin (BTC) liquidity and price volatility. The report highlights a critical negative gamma concentration between the $60,000 and $70,000 price levels.
